Split and Damaged Fascia
Fascias are board-like structures that run horizontally along the roofline and hold the guttering in place. Over time, exposure to the aspects can cause them to break or end up being distorted. Timely replacement or repair of the fascia can prevent water from leaking into the roof and harming the structure of the home.
2. Soffit Decay
Soffits cover the area below the roofline, providing ventilation and avoiding insects from getting in the attic. Wetness can trigger soffits to rot, jeopardizing their performance. Replacement of harmed soffits can boost both aesthetic appeals and ventilation.
3. Gutter Maintenance
Gutters gather rainwater from the roofing and funnel it away from the residential or commercial property's foundation. When rain gutters are clogged with particles, they can overflow, causing significant water damage. Routine cleaning and maintenance are vital to guarantee correct drain.
4. Inspecting Downpipes
Downpipes channel water from seamless gutters to a drainage system. Disconnections or obstructions in these pipes can result in water pooling, which can wear down the foundation. Regular checks are necessary to make sure all components are intact.

FAQs about Roofline Repairs
1. How typically should I inspect my roofline?
It is advisable to examine your roofline a minimum of when a year, ideally throughout the spring and fall.
2. What signs show a need for roofline repairs?
Signs include visible cracks, peeling paint on fascias, stopped up gutters, and drooping soffits.
3. Can I repair roofline concerns in the cold weather?
While some minor repairs might be feasible, it is generally best to wait on warmer weather condition due to the risk of ice and snow.
4. How can I extend the life of my roofline?
Routine maintenance, such as cleaning up rain gutters and looking for damage, can considerably extend the life-span of roofline elements.
